vallium: Stop using lower_ubo_ssbo_access_to_offsets
This legacy path needs to die. Drivers shouldn't be using it anymore. While we're here, we also implement the resource_reindex intrinsic which doesn't come up in most direct-access cases but can depending on how the OpAccessChains are structured. It comes up all the time in the variable pointers world. Reviewed-by: Dave Airlie <airlied@redhat.com> Part-of: <https://gitlab.freedesktop.org/mesa/mesa/-/merge_requests/5275>
